How to prepare Favorite Chicken Marinade
Ingredients:
- 1/4 cup soy sauce 🍶
- 1/4 cup olive oil 🫒
- 2 tablespoons honey 🍯
- 2 tablespoons apple cider vinegar 🍏
- 2 cloves garlic, minced 🧄
- 1 teaspoon ground black pepper 🧂
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ano 🌿
Instructions:
- In a medium-sized bowl, combine the soy sauce, olive oil, honey, and apple cider vinegar. Mix well until the honey is dissolved.
- Add the minced garlic, ground black pepper, and dried oregano to the bowl. Stir until everything is well incorporated.
- Place your chicken in a resealable plastic bag or a shallow dish. Pour the marinade over the chicken, ensuring it’s well-coated.
- Seal the bag or cover the dish and refrigerate. Let the chicken marinate for at least 30 minutes, but longer for more flavor (up to 24 hours is ideal!).
- Remove the chicken from the marinade before cooking. Discard the used marinade.

How to store Favorite Chicken Marinade
If you have leftover marinade (that hasn’t touched raw chicken), you can store it in an airtight container in the fridge for up to a week. However, once it has come into contact with raw chicken, it must be discarded for safety reasons.
Tips for preparing Favorite Chicken Marinade
- For extra flavor, try adding citrus zest (like lemon or lime) to the marinade.
- If you like spice, consider adding some red pepper flakes or a dash of hot sauce.
- Always marinate chicken in the refrigerator to prevent bacterial growth.

FAQs
1. How long should I marinate chicken?
For the best flavor, marinate chicken for at least 30 minutes. However, for maximum taste, you can marinate it for up to 24 hours.
